This policy doesn't prevent Microsoft Edge Update from running or prevent users from installing Microsoft Edge software using other methods. This only affects the installation of Microsoft Edge software when the ' Allow installation' policy is set to Not Configured. If you disable this policy, the installation of Microsoft Edge is blocked.

You can override this policy for individual channels by enabling the ' Allow installation' policy for specific channels. You can specify the default behavior of all channels to allow or block Microsoft Edge on domain-joined devices.
